Car key programming is the process of connecting an electronic car key fob to your vehicle in order to open and start your car. It is a beneficial technology for a variety of reasons, including that it makes it difficult for thieves to gain access to your car, as they are unable to use a programmed key to unlock or start your car. It also lets you store multiple key fobs in one remote, meaning that you don't have to carry around multiple keys.

skoda-logo.jpgModern cars have transponder chips embedded in their key fobs that communicate with the vehicle's system to identify the driver and begin the engine. The transponder chip is a unique coded signal that the vehicle detects and analyzes to verify the authenticity of the key fob. The vehicle must match the unique code signal with the correct keyfob in order to program an entirely new one. This can be accomplished with a specific key programming tool, which communicates with the car in order to copy the current key and then transmits the code to a new fob. In some cars, the EEPROM or module chip might need to be removed in order to allow reprogramming. However, other key programs can also be made through the J2534 Interface.

Be sure to have two keys that work before you begin reprogramming the car key. You'll need one functioning key to connect the new fob to your car's systems and the other key is required to turn off and on the ignition. Check out the owner's manual in case you're not acquainted with the anti-theft system of your vehicle. You may need to follow additional steps to connect a key to your system. You can also search for the make and model of your car online to find the exact instructions for your vehicle. Metal keys for cars used to rely on freshly cut teeth to open car key reprogramming locks and operating the ignition. Now smart car keys equipped with transponders replace these conventional keys by incorporating a tiny computer chip inside every key fob that communicates with the vehicle's system. Transponder keys lost or stolen should be programmed by an locksmith or mechanic to get the car started. The process takes anywhere from 30 minutes to an hour for most cars.
